Loading Paper
The EPI-4000 can print on a wide range of paper and envelope sizes,
including letter, legal, and ledger size paper, and #6, #10, and DL
size envelopes. The printer’s default (factory) paper size setting is
letter size, so you can use single sheets of letter size paper without
changing the paper size setting. To use envelopes or other sizes of
single sheet paper, you need to change the paper size. For a list of
the paper and envelope sizes you can use with the EPI-4000 or to
change the paper size, see the section on the SelecType paper size
menu in Chapter 2.
The EPI-4000 can also print pages in either of two orientations.
Portrait (or vertical) orientation, the more common setting, prints
across the page’s width. You use portrait orientation for printing
letters and other pages of text. Landscape (or horizontal) orientation
prints across the page’s length. Landscape orientation provides a
wider printing space for spreadsheets, graphics, and tables. The
default (factory-set) orientation is portrait. For more information on
portrait and landscape orientation or to select landscape orientation,
see the section on the SelecType printing orientation menu in
Chapter 2.
Note: This chapter tells you how to choose and load single-sheet
paper and envelopes. If you install the optional push tractor, the
printer can also print on continuous paper. The optional push
tractor comes with its own manual. For information on paper you
can use with the tractor and for instructions on how to load paper
onto the tractor, see the push tractor manual.
